Q&A: Your Top Solar Kit Concerns Addressed

1. What maintenance do DIY systems require?

Annual cleaning and connection checks (45 minutes typically). Our panels come with 25-year performance warranties.

2. Can I expand my system later?

Yes. Our modular design lets you add panels incrementally - 83% of users upgrade within 5 years.

3. How do government incentives work?

The US federal tax credit covers 30% of kit costs. Many states add local rebates - California's SGIP program offers $0.25 per watt stored.
